- | [ | + | [https://www.uniprot.org/uniprot/CHKA_HUMAN CHKA_HUMAN] Has a key role in phospholipid biosynthesis and may contribute to tumor cell growth. Catalyzes the first step in phosphatidylcholine biosynthesis. Contributes to phosphatidylethanolamine biosynthesis. Phosphorylates choline and ethanolamine. Has higher activity with choline.<ref>PMID:19915674</ref> |
